maintain intervention
[meɪnˈteɪn ɪntərˈvenʃən]
verb phrase / noun phrase
manter intervenção
1. to continue or sustain an act of intervening in a situation, conflict, or process to influence its outcome
The UN decided to maintain intervention in the conflict zone to prevent further escalation.
A ONU decidiu manter intervenção na zona de conflito para evitar maior escalação.
2. to keep ongoing involvement in a medical, surgical, or therapeutic procedure
The doctors chose to maintain intervention with medication rather than surgery.
Os médicos escolheram manter intervenção com medicação ao invés de cirurgia.
3. to preserve or uphold involvement in political, economic, or social affairs
The government decided to maintain intervention in the market during the economic crisis.
O governo decidiu manter intervenção no mercado durante a crise econômica.
In Brazilian Portuguese and international English, 'maintain intervention' is commonly used in diplomatic, medical, and political contexts. In Brazil, this phrase appears frequently in news media discussing military operations, peacekeeping missions, and public health responses. In the USA, it's often used in foreign policy and medical decision-making discussions.
